UFS v5.0/UFSHCI v5.0 adds HS-G6 support (46.6 Gbps/lane) via UniPro
v3.0 and M-PHY v6.0. These specs define TX Equalization for all
High-Speed Gears (not only HS-G6) to compensate channel loss and
improve signal integrity at high speed.
For HS-G6, M-PHY uses PAM4 1b1b line coding. Pre-Coding may also be
required depending on channel characteristics.
Document vendor-neutral properties in ufs-common.yaml:
- txeq-preshoot-g[1-6]
- txeq-deemphasis-g[1-6]
- tx-precode-enable-g6
Values are per-lane Host/Device tuples (2 values for x1, 4 values for
x2). PreShoot/DeEmphasis range from 0..7, and Precode is 0/1.
These are board-specific signal-integrity tuning values. They depend on
channel SI/PHY characterization and validation (host PHY, device PHY,
package, and board routing), and are determined by HW/PHY designers.
Although UFSHCI v5.0 supports TX Equalization Training via UniPro v3.0,
which allows host software to determine optimal TX Equalization at
runtime, static board-specific TX Equalization settings in the Device
Tree are still necessary because:
- TX Equalization Training is not supported for HS-G3 and below
- TX Equalization Training is disabled on some platforms

Parse board-specific static TX Equalization settings from Device Tree for
each HS gear and store them in hba->tx_eq_params.
Parse txeq-preshoot-g[1-6] and txeq-deemphasis-g[1-6] as per-lane tuples:
<Host_Lane0 Device_Lane0>, [<Host_Lane1 Device_Lane1>].
For HS-G6, parse optional tx-precode-enable-g6 using the same per-lane
Host/Device tuple format. If provided, it must contain values for all
active lanes, and each value must be 0 or 1.
Introduce from_dt in struct ufshcd_tx_eq_params to track whether TX EQ
values came from static Device Tree data.
When TX Equalization Training is used, static settings are not final:
- If valid settings are retrieved from qTxEQGnSettings/wTxEQGnSettingsExt,
those retrieved settings override static Device Tree settings.
- If retrieval is not available/valid, TX EQTR runs and trained settings
override static Device Tree settings.
No behavior changes for platforms that do not provide these properties.

+static int ufshcd_parse_tx_precode_enable(struct ufs_hba *hba,
+ bool host_precode_en[UFS_MAX_LANES],
+ bool device_precode_en[UFS_MAX_LANES])
+{
+ const char *prop_name = "tx-precode-enable-g6";
+ u32 num_elems = 2 * hba->lanes_per_direction;
+ const u32 lpd = hba->lanes_per_direction;
+ u32 precode[UFS_MAX_LANES * 2];
+ struct device *dev = hba->dev;
+ struct property *prop;
+ int count, err, i;
+
+ prop = of_find_property(dev->of_node, prop_name, NULL);
+ if (!prop)
+ return 0;
+
+ count = of_property_count_u32_elems(dev->of_node, prop_name);
+ if (count < 0)
+ return count;
+
+ if (count != num_elems) {
+ dev_err(dev, "Property %s has invalid count (%d), expecting %u\n",
+ prop_name, count, num_elems);
+ return -EINVAL;
+ }
+
+ err = of_property_read_u32_array(dev->of_node, prop_name, precode, num_elems);
+ if (err) {
+ dev_err(dev, "Failed to read %s property, %d\n", prop_name, err);
+ return err;
+ }
+
+ for (i = 0; i < num_elems; i++) {
+ if (precode[i] > 1) {
+ dev_err(dev, "Invalid TX precode value (%u) in %s property\n",
+ precode[i], prop_name);
+ return -EINVAL;
+ }
+ }
+
+ for (i = 0; i < lpd; i++) {
+ host_precode_en[i] = precode[i * 2];
+ device_precode_en[i] = precode[i * 2 + 1];
+ }
+
+ return 0;
+}
+
+static int ufshcd_parse_tx_eq_value_array(struct ufs_hba *hba,
+ const char *prop_name,
+ const u32 max_value,
+ u32 values[UFS_MAX_LANES * 2])
+{
+ u32 num_elems = 2 * hba->lanes_per_direction;
+ struct device *dev = hba->dev;
+ int count, err, i;
+
+ count = of_property_count_u32_elems(dev->of_node, prop_name);
+ if (count < 0)
+ return count;
+
+ if (count != num_elems) {
+ dev_err(dev, "Property %s has invalid count (%d), expecting %u\n",
+ prop_name, count, num_elems);
+ return -EINVAL;
+ }
+
+ err = of_property_read_u32_array(dev->of_node, prop_name, values, num_elems);
+ if (err) {
+ dev_err(dev, "Failed to read %s property, %d\n", prop_name, err);
+ return err;
+ }
+
+ for (i = 0; i < num_elems; i++) {
+ if (values[i] >= max_value) {
+ dev_err(dev, "Invalid TX EQ value (%u) in %s property\n",
+ values[i], prop_name);
+ return -EINVAL;
+ }
+ }
+
+ return 0;
+}
+
+/**
+ * ufshcd_parse_tx_eq_settings_for_gear - Parse static TX EQ DT settings for one gear
+ * @hba: per adapter instance
+ * @gear: target HS gear
+ *
+ * Reads the txeq-preshoot-gN, txeq-deemphasis-gN, and (for G6)
+ * tx-precode-enable-g6 device-tree properties.
+ * If all present values are valid, stores them as static TX Equalization
+ * settings for the given gear.
+ */
+static void ufshcd_parse_tx_eq_settings_for_gear(struct ufs_hba *hba, int gear)
+{
+ bool device_precode_en[UFS_MAX_LANES] = { false };
+ bool host_precode_en[UFS_MAX_LANES] = { false };
+ const u32 lpd = hba->lanes_per_direction;
+ struct ufshcd_tx_eq_params *params;
+ u32 deemphasis[UFS_MAX_LANES * 2];
+ u32 preshoot[UFS_MAX_LANES * 2];
+ char prop_name[MAX_PROP_SIZE];
+ int err, lane;
+
+ snprintf(prop_name, MAX_PROP_SIZE, "txeq-preshoot-g%d", gear);
+ err = ufshcd_parse_tx_eq_value_array(hba, prop_name, TX_HS_NUM_PRESHOOT, preshoot);
+ if (err)
+ return;
+
+ snprintf(prop_name, MAX_PROP_SIZE, "txeq-deemphasis-g%d", gear);
+ err = ufshcd_parse_tx_eq_value_array(hba, prop_name, TX_HS_NUM_DEEMPHASIS, deemphasis);
+ if (err)
+ return;
+
+ if (gear == UFS_HS_G6) {
+ err = ufshcd_parse_tx_precode_enable(hba, host_precode_en, device_precode_en);
+ if (err)
+ return;
+ }
+
+ params = &hba->tx_eq_params[gear - 1];
+ for (lane = 0; lane < lpd; lane++) {
+ params->host[lane].preshoot = preshoot[lane * 2];
+ params->host[lane].deemphasis = deemphasis[lane * 2];
+ params->host[lane].precode_en = host_precode_en[lane];
+
+ params->device[lane].preshoot = preshoot[lane * 2 + 1];
+ params->device[lane].deemphasis = deemphasis[lane * 2 + 1];
+ params->device[lane].precode_en = device_precode_en[lane];
+ }
+
+ params->is_valid = true;
+ params->from_dt = true;
+}
+
+static void ufshcd_parse_static_tx_eq_settings(struct ufs_hba *hba)
+{
+ const u32 lpd = hba->lanes_per_direction;
+ int gear;
+
+ if (!lpd)
+ return;
+
+ if (lpd > UFS_MAX_LANES) {
+ dev_warn(hba->dev, "lanes_per_direction (%u) exceeds UFS_MAX_LANES (%u)\n",
+ lpd, UFS_MAX_LANES);
+ return;
+ }
+
+ for (gear = UFS_HS_G1; gear <= UFS_HS_GEAR_MAX; gear++)
+ ufshcd_parse_tx_eq_settings_for_gear(hba, gear);
+}
